PRIMARY FUNCTION
The primary function for a Fleet Manager is to utilize coaching and leadership skills to manage approximately 35-40 drivers and achieve specific goals. These goals include meeting pick-up and delivery requirements, maximizing revenue, driver productivity, and other established company goals for retaining drivers and achieving an excellent safety record.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Review driver check calls to determine driver location and estimated delivery times. Receive load assignments from Customer Service and review to ensure the appropriateness of such driver work assignments. Dispatch loads to the drivers (issue load information, loading instructions, directions, routing, and fuel information). Call customers to obtain directions information and schedule loading/delivery appointments, as necessary. Notify Customer Service Department of issues/changes that might impact customer expectations or affect load assignments. Promote safety throughout all areas of operations, including the dispatching of loads in accordance with the drivers hours of availability. Focus on driver retention by understanding driver requirements/preferences, by monitoring driver performance to ensure driver requirements are being met, and by keeping drivers informed and motivated. Identify, track, and resolve performance issues by conducting driver evaluations and driver route and hold meetings. Resolve driver conflicts, problems, and requests with respect to matters such as, hometime, pay, equipment, and load assignments. Ensure the awareness of and enforce company policies. Maintain records pertaining to driver performance and productivity. Participate as an active member in Quality/Kaizen teams and attend company meetings, as necessary.
